1.8(top 50%)
impact factor
904(top 20%)
16.7K(top 10%)
48(top 20%)
2.1(top 20%)
extended IF
all documents
doc citations
107(top 10%)

Top Schools (by citations)

#SchoolArticlesCitationsR ARankR CRank
1Department of Mathematics21,1911031
2Department of Electrical Engineering2630361
3Department of Computer Science42739769
4School of Computer Science62593337
5School of Computer Science22448934
6Department of Computer Science and Artificial Intelligence1023666
7Department of Computer Science916065156
8Department of Computer Science2128102
9Department of Computer Science31241514
10Department of Chemistry812368131
11Department of Computer Science211862
12Department of Computer Science and Computer Engineering911626
13Department of Computer Science81122582
14Department of Computer Science and Engineering210014164
15Faculty of Mathematics and Computer Science3994917
16School of Biomedical Engineering1903523
16Department of Computer Science19093
18College of Management5872147
19School of Electrical and Electronic Engineering383501474
20Leiden Institute of Advanced Computer Science579423
21Department of Mathematics173223
22Department of Mathematics5722927
22Faculty of Economics and Business Administration1726419
24Department of Mathematics27078
25Department of Computer Science2652119
26Department of Computer Science5641764
27Department of Applied Mathematics16287
27Department of Physics1624515
29Department of Automatic Control and Systems Engineering16094
30Turku Centre for Biotechnology1531219
30School of Electrical Engineering25311788
30School of Computer Science and Engineering25310479
30College of Software Engineering25334
34Key Laboratory of Image Processing and Intelligent Control1513824
34Department of Computer Science1512727
36Department of Computer Science104621134
37Department of Automatic Control and Systems Engineering145200150
38Institute of Physics144339238
38Institute of Physical Chemistry144405281
40School of Education2436287
40Department of Computational Intelligence and Systems Science2435273
40Department of Computer Science543832
43Department of Computer Science1422731
44Department of Computer Science1417151
44College of Computer and Information Sciences141197160
46Division of Medicinal Chemistry1402635
46Department of Financial and Management Engineering1403628
46Department of Production Engineering and Management1407598
49Department of Artificial Intelligence1393227
50Department of Ecology and Evolutionary Biology338122268
50Department of Industrial Engineering and Business Information Systems1381921
52Department of Electrical and Computer Engineering137219217
52Department of Computer and Information Science1375063
54Department of Electronics and Telecommunication Engineering13610972
55Department of Organismic and Evolutionary Biology135338384
55Department of Engineering135972922
55Department of Computer Science4352991
55Department of Computer Science1352215
55Electrical Engineering Department1356751
55Department of Business Management23512
61Department of Computer Science234112142
61Department of Mathematics1343313
63Department of Chemical and Biomolecular Engineering133192237
64School of Electric and Information Engineering231516
65Department of Chemistry130383425
66Department of Electrical Engineering and Computer Sciences229223386
66Department of Computer Science129122156
66School of Computer Science and Electronic Engineering229129185
66School of Mathematics and Computer Science22911
70Department of Bioengineering128332365
70Department of Electronic Engineering2283461
72Department of Chemistry and Biochemistry127235255
72Department of Mathematics127201136
74Department of Computer Science3261133
74Graduate School of Information Science and Technology226178234
74Department of Computer Science126217254
74Department of Physics126415407
74Department of Cognitive Psychology12614
74Graduate School of Information Science and Technology126268172
74Department of Mathematics and Computer Science3262362
74Department of Computer Science42635156
74Department of Computer Engineering1262233
74Department of Computer Engineering126147
84School of Information and Control Engineering125154130
84School of Information Science and Engineering125170147
84Department of Industrial Engineering1256479
84Department of Electrical Engineering125209163
84Department of Electronics and Communication Engineering125227171
89Institute of Mathematics and Computer Science42446
89Department of Computer Science22413
89Institute of Physics22412
92Division of Chemistry and Chemical Engineering123350473
92Department of Computer Science and Software Engineering12333
94School of Physics and Astronomy322117254
94Department of Computer and Information Science and Engineering12283105
94School of Electrical Engineering and Computer Science122198213
94School of Business Administration1222133
94Department of Electrical and Computer Engineering22299164
99Department of Computer Science52118152
100Department of Electrical Engineering120286356
100Department of Computer Science120416
100Control and Simulation Center1203924
100Department of Computer Science1205976
104College of Computer Science and Technology11911599
105Department of Biophysics and Biochemistry118160209
105College of Physics and Electronic Engineering1188382
107Department of Mathematics217112175
107Department of Bioengineering117131223
107Department of Psychology117176292
107Department of Experimental Oncology117168243
107Department of Computer Science31739
107Institute of Computer Science517515
113Department of Chemistry116544671
113Department of Computer Science31659235
113Faculty of Computer Science116127191
113Department of Computer Science1163855
113Department of Chemistry116398535
113Department of Computer Science11645
113Department of Parasitology116127208
113College of Information Science and Engineering116368363
121Department of Computer Science31562138
121Department of Computer Science1151517
121Department of Computer Science21535128
121Department of Computer Science21565197
121College of Computer Science and Technology215156245
121Department of Computer Science11511
127Institute of Medical Science114704902
127Department of Computer Engineering21451124
127Graduate School of Science and Engineering114252259
130School of Medicine1139671.4K
130Department of Mathematics1136570
130Department of Computer Science1131119
130Institute of Mathematics and Computer Science1133027
130School of Physics and Astronomy213115236
130School of Management Science and Engineering1133455
130School of Computer and Information Science11375101
130Department of Applied Optics and Photonics1132123
130Department of Electrical and Computer Engineering113217289
130School of Computer Science and Engineering113146134
130Department of Applied Electronics and Instrumentation Engineering11322
130Department of Electronics and Communication Engineering1132422
130Department of Computer Science1134683
143College of Life Sciences112441594
143Institute of Computer Science1121212
143School of Computer Science and Technology112159181
143Department of Mathematics212337439
143Department of Life Sciences112274457
143School of Computer and Information1122023
149Department of Computer Science and Information Engineering111210269
149Department of Mathematics11192119
149Department of Computer Science111135266
149Department of Computer Science21188199
149Department of Mathematics and Statistics4111695
149School of Statistics2111742
149Department of Computer Science211814
149Department of Linguistics11149
149Department of Biology11197172
149Department of Computer Science1113981
149Department of Mathematics11167
149Department of Mathematics1116167
161School of Computer Science and Engineering11086130
161Department of Information Engineering2102456
161Graduate School of Engineering210377630
161School of Science and Engineering110358463
161School of Engineering and Computing Sciences110121216
161Department of Biochemistry11086161
161Department of Biology210365856
161Department of Electronics21094191
161Department of Complex Systems Science1104250
161Graduate School of Information Science110181226
161Department of Computer Science21060145
161School of Mathematical and Computer Sciences21029131
161School of Computer Science11096108
161School of Electronic Engineering110180202
175Department of Computer Science194482
175Department of Computer Science2952123
175Ministry of Education19228331
175College of Information Science and Technology19135167
175Department of Mathematics196967
175Faculty of Electrical and Electronics Engineering2962157
175Faculty of Natural Sciences and Mathematics194859
175Faculty of Technical Engineering1944
175Department of Computer Engineering19309394
175School of Computer and Information Technology191413
185Department of Electrical and Computer Engineering18169273
185Department of Electrical and Computer Engineering18270378
185Department of Computer Science and Software Engineering184471
185School of Information and Electrical Engineering1883129
185Department of Mathematics184276
185Department of Biomedical Engineering1839109
185Department of Applied and Computational Mechanics1817
185Computer Information Systems Department1846
185Department of Computer Science18615
194Faculty of Computer and Information Science17132263
194School of Mechanical Engineering17168230
194Department of Pharmacy17109244
194Faculty of Engineering17533812
194Department of Electrical Engineering and Electronics27181414
194Department of Theoretical Physics171827
194Department of Computer Science and Information Systems5714
194Institute of Mathematics171418
194Department of Mathematics17107124
194Department of Computer Science37320
204Department of Physics16119208
204Department of Computer Science162370
204Department of Computer Science26424
204Department of Computer Science and Engineering1685111
204College of Computer and Control Engineering1664129
204Faculty of Mathematics and Computer Science2643107
204School of Electrical Engineering16123186
204Faculty of Electrical Engineering and Computer Science1612
204Institute of Operating Systems and Computer Networks16915
204College of Information Science and Engineering1686128
204Department of Computer Architecture and Technology163066
204Department of Electromechanical Engineering16119192
204Department of Computer Science164976
204School of Mechanical Engineering16272374
204Department of Computer Science and Engineering161520
219Department of Mathematics and Statistics4517176
219Department of Computer Science15134236
219Department of Computer Engineering151838
219Center for Biomedical Engineering151555
219Graduate School of Engineering15744982
219Department of Mathematics and Computer Science153263
219School of Computer Science and Technology15167241
219Department of Mathematics252980
219Faculty of Engineering1559
228School of Electronics Engineering and Computer Science24148348
228Faculty of Electrical Engineering14168300
228School of Engineering and Applied Sciences2411115
228Department of Computer and Information Science2455265
228Department of Computer Science143283
228Department of Information and Computer Science2419121
228Institute of Computer Science14111223
228Department of Physics24221459
228Group of Applied Physics1456101
228Center of Applied Ecology and Sustainability (CAPES)14327
228Institute of Mathematics14215278
228School of Life Sciences14531919
228Department of Electrical and Computer Engineering14132242
228Institute of Mathematics and Computer Science1446106
228Department of Computer Science14416
228Department of Computer Science1499230
228School of Computer and Software14142222
228Department of Applied Mathematics and Computational Sciences241050
228Department of Computer Science141229
228Department of Electrical and Computer Engineering143880
248Centre of Biological Engineering13215434
248Department of Ecology and Evolutionary Biology13193376
248Department of Biochemistry and Molecular Biology13204378
248Department of Mathematics and Computer Science1353177
248Centre for Integrative Physiology13108274
248School of Physics and Engineering13182266
248School of Electrical and Electronic Engineering13227405
248Department of Electrical and Computer Engineering13239434
248Department of Anthropology13146349
248Department of Physics13161310
248Department of Mathematics and Statistics13135261
248Department of Information Engineering13176352
248College of Electronic Engineering133758
248Department of Computer Science133068
248Faculty of Electrical Engineering13364636
248Department of Mathematics1396143
248Faculty of Information Science and Technology1372155
248Department of Informatics and Applied Mathematics131436
248Department of Computer Science and Engineering1375142
248School of Computer Science and Engineering131334
248Department of Computer Science13116
269Department of Quantum Engineering and Systems Science1292154
269School of Engineering128921.3K
269Department of Electrical and Computer Engineering12377612
269Department of Computer Science1270176
269Department of Mathematics and Applied Mathematics12103187
269Institute of Cybernetics1266145
269Department of Computer Science1269117
269School of Life Sciences12408774
269School of Chemistry and Chemical Engineering12445703
269Department of Computer Science12262456
269School of Management12237452
269Institute of Cognitive Science1227119
269Department of Computer Science123198
269Department of Mathematics and Statistics12187343
269Department of Mathematics12610
269Department of Mathematics and Computer Science121434
269Department of Chemical and Physical Sciences1260143
269Robotics Research Institute12524
287Department of Electrical Engineering11426704
287Department of Computer Science and Engineering11136251
287Department of Computer Science and Engineering2138219
287Department of Physics11142269
287Department of Computer Science11102225
287Department of Electrical Engineering11237403
287Department of Computer Science and Engineering111839
287College of Information Science and Engineering11110216
287Department of Electrical Engineering and Information Technology11102235
287Department of Physics and Astronomy1160154
287School of Mathematics and Statistics11151352
287Department of Electrical Engineering1159148
287Department of Mathematical Science and Electrical-Electronic-Computer Engineering111021
287Department of Computer Science11416
287Department of Computer Science2163335
287School of Artificial Intelligence and Automation11163264
287College of Food Science and Engineering1159120
287Department of Electrical and Electronic Engineering111946
287Department of Computer Science11712
306School of Life Sciences and Technology10181403
306Department of Computer Science101764
306Department of Computer Science1062208
306Department of Mathematics10516
306School of Mathematics and Statistics10309596
306Department of Computer Science1049128
306School of Electrical Engineering and Computer Science2097351
306College of Computer Science10203339
306School of Computer Science2055229
306Department of Computer Science1033105
306Department of Physics103884
306Center for High Assurance Computer Systems10617
306Intelligent Robotics Lab1046
306Department of Mathematics and Computer Science1085237
306Computer Science Department2017
306Department of Electrical and Electronic Engineering1060133
306School of Life Sciences and Technology1047118
306Department of Mathematics and Computing Science102669
306Graduate School of Engineering10299504